Help W/Fog Lights WTB:

So I bought OEM replacement fog lamp assemblies. I am told I need relays and a switch. I would like to buy if you anyone has available. If you have any install insight please let me know.

FYI: My T4R does not have fog switch on Turn/Lights Stalk.

I also need clips to mount cross bars to factory rails on my 99' Base T4R.

And don't go any smaller in wire gauge than your fog light assembly wiring..A 30 amp relay should be sufficient for the application..as for the switch you can either buy from your local electronics store or get the OEM Toyota switch for a more factory look.

As Elton said, make sure to run a relay. Check if you have a spot for a relay in the fuse block under the hood. If your rig is prewired from the factory, you can tap into the existing wires for your new lights.

My '01 doesn't have a switch on the stalk either, previous owner installed a switch (p/n 00550-35976) on the dash.
